Social History of Contemporary Democratic Media HEA024000 The UN Millennium Project wasThe last few decades have helped dispel the myth that media should remain driven by high end professionals and market share. This book puts forward the concept of "communications from below" in contrast to the "globalization from above" that characterizes many new developments in international organization and media practices.
